Managing the Spread of Invasive Gazania

Gazania, a attractive flowering plant native to South Africa, can become an invasive nuisance when introduced to new environments. Its rapid growth and ability to prosper in a variety of situations allow it to easily overwhelm native flora, disrupting the delicate harmony of natural habitats.

To mitigate the spread of invasive Gazania, it's crucial to utilize a integrated approach that includes both preventative and control measures. One effective strategy is to encourage the use of native plant species in landscaping and gardening, thus decreasing the desire for invasive plants like Gazania.

Another crucial step is to inspect areas susceptible to Gazania infestation, allowing for timely detection and management. Pesticide control can be effective, but it should be used with awareness and in accordance with local regulations.

Finally, public awareness about the dangers of invasive species is paramount. By encouraging responsible plant choices and underscoring the importance of environment conservation, we can collectively work towards controlling the spread of invasive Gazania and protecting our natural resources.

Preserve Your Landscape: Know Your Gazania

Gazanias, also recognized as treasure flowers, are vibrant annuals that flourish in sunny climates. These beautiful blooms bring a burst of color to landscapes, and with the right care, they can provide weeks of gorgeous displays. However, understanding their specific requirements is essential for ensuring a healthy and thriving gazania.

To successfully grow and maintain your gazanias, it's important to become aware of their unique features. This knowledge will help you in providing the optimal growing conditions and stopping common problems.

  • FirstConsider starting with picking a spot that receives at least four hours of direct sunlight each day. Gazanias crave the sun!
  • Ensure the soil is well-drained to avoid root rot. A sandy loam works ideally
  • Water your gazanias regularly, but avoid overwatering. They prefer slightly moist soil.
